“Dedicated” and “Open” frequent flyer reward programs

We need to distinguish between Dedicated and Open frequent flyer reward programs.

Dedicated programs are those programs in which the frequent flyer miles can only be redeemed on one airline and its subsidiaries. A good example of this is the Rapid Rewards Visa® Signature Card discussed in the previous chapter, which earns you flights only on its airline.

Open frequent flyer reward programs offer rewards that can be used either on most major airlines, if you use the credit card issuer’s preferred travel agency partner, or a large selection of participating airlines. In most cases there are redemption fees that must be paid when obtaining your free flight.

How do you decide which is best for you?


The answer depends upon a couple of issues. The first is how much risk you are willing to assume, and the second issue revolves around whether or not the airline you frequent the most has its own dedicated frequent flyer reward program. Let’s look at the risks first.
